Writing Routinely for Many Tasks
Aligned to W.11-12.10 — Common Core State Standards for English Language Arts.
What this lesson teaches
Fluent writers work across timeframes — a quick reflection in ten minutes, a research paper over weeks — and adjust to each task, purpose, and audience. Regular writing builds the stamina and flexibility strong communication requires.
Worked example
In one week you might draft a timed exam response, a lab summary, and a personal essay — each demanding a different pace and voice.
Practice questions
- Plan a piece you could draft in ten minutes.
- Contrast the demands of a quick task and a long project.
- Explain how purpose changes how much you plan.
